look. Three floors, a conservatory and a gravity platform: Airbus unveils a futuristic new space station | Sciences

Will astronauts fly to Mars in about ten years using the Airbus space station? If it depends on the European space giant, yes. So the company unveils a space station concept that is fully compatible with the latest rockets.

The station is called “Loop” and has three adjustable floors connected by a tube with a conservatory around it. Beating is the “centrifugal surface” where artificial gravity is generated. The muscles and bones of the human body deteriorate when not used, and artificial gravity is supposed to prevent this. In addition, weightlessness also overwhelms our nervous system and sense of direction, and often makes astronauts nauseous during the first days of their stay in space.

Even more remarkable is the cylindrical shape of the new station with a diameter of 8, which allows it to be launched entirely with the latest missiles. This way you no longer have to be at a loss for space. There is room for four people in the station, but it can be expanded to eight.

Airbus says it can get it ready in the early 2030s, which is when the International Space Station has reached the end of its life cycle. They can serve both for short orbits around the Earth or the Moon, and for long flights to Mars.
